2024 Fantasy Outlook
It was a season for the ages for the academy schools last season, and the Midshipmen got the last laugh in the regular-season finale with a rather one-sided victory over Army, followed by a one-point win over Oklahoma in the bowl game. Horvath was front-and-center in the offense, completing 57.6 percent of his 139 pass attempts for 1,353 yards and a 13:4 TD:INT ratio. As is usually the case in a triple-option offense, he was even more impressive on the ground, totaling 175 carries for 1,246 yards and 17 scores. He missed most of Weeks 12 and 14 due to injury, so those numbers could have ranged even higher had he stayed healthy for the season's entirety. Horvath is set to reclaim the duties under center in 2025 and should have another huge season in store. As always, Navy players carry with them an additional bye week that others don't have to account for, but Horvath's weekly production should more than make up for it, and he should prove to rank among the best quarterback options among quarterbacks in fantasy drafts this fall. Ends career with a bang
Horvath completed 9 of 15 passes for 108 yards and two touchdowns during Friday's 35-13 Liberty Bowl win versus Cincinnati. He also had 16 rushes for 53 yards with one touchdown.
ANALYSIS
Horvath had some struggles down the stretch, including a rather mediocre showing against Army in the annual matchup to close out the regular season, but he found his form again in the bowl game. Horvath finishes his senior season having completed a career-best 60.6 percent of his 160 pass attempts for 1,580 yards and a 12:6 TD:INT ratio, adding 224 carries for 1,200 yards and 16 touchdowns as a rusher. Per the broadcast, he will shift his focus to becoming a Navy pilot with his football career now in the rearview.

Sufficient over Army
Horvath completed 7 of 14 passes for 82 yards, one touchdown and one interception during Saturday's 17-16 victory against Army. He also had 34 rushes for 107 yards with one touchdown.

Throws and rushes for a score
Horvath was five of nine passing for 100 yards and one touchdown during Thursday's 28-17 win versus Memphis. He also had 15 rushes for 54 yards with one touchdown.

Gets banged up during big win
Horvath was eight of 15 passing for 147 yards and one touchdown during Saturday's 41-38 victory versus South Florida. He also had 21 rushes for 60 yards.
